"The Hall of Fame" is somewhat misleadingly named art gallery / general store. Above its door hangs a sign of a painter's palette, and the windows are decorated with oil portraits of.. what seems to be mostly fish and floral arrangements. However, the store does not sell only painting supplies or the owner's (quite ubiquitous) art, it sells almost anything one might need or want ... from a general store. For more adventurous needs, the owner advices the customer to seek help from her cousin, Rurden the Fifth at Rurden's Armoury.   Amaryllis Wilderbee is an eccentric dwarven woman who is passionate about the finer things in life, oil painting in particular. She keeps an atelier on the second floor of her store, but painting alone is a rather expensive hobby, and even in a town the size of Easthaven, there are only so many portraits one can paint, so she has turned to painting still life paintings of ... well, fish.   The store is rather cramped, and seems to contain a multitude of items one might never even think to consider buying. It does not, however, sell groceries. For those, one might choose to go to the market square and the adjoining shops there.
